Beste Yuksel may soon put quite a few piano lecturers out of work.

The Ph.D candidate at Tufts university in Massachusetts has created a tool that helps students examine the instrument quicker and with extra accuracy than they might beneath the watchful eye of a traditional trainer, or while training on their very own. known as BACh, for brain automatic Chorales (and an evident nod to considered one of historical past’s most prolific composers), the gadget has one major benefit over human lecturers: it could actually learn your mind.

The BACh device measures one thing called “cognitive load,” which is a fancy time period for a way a lot mental exertion is required to study something new. the normal way for learning the piano is one hand at a time. as soon as a student can get via a line on the best hand, they transfer on to the left hand. however there’s no solution to inform how arduous their mind has to work to get via that line. Some people might breeze through it quick, and their cognitive load is low, this means that they’re truly prepared to move on. Others can have to work actually exhausting, so their cognitive load is heavy, they usually’re in danger for mental exhaustion. “that might point out that they’re overloaded and also you want to lower the amount of knowledge,” Yuksel explains.

when we study something new, we’re more or less operating at midnight in regards to how smartly our brains are in fact absorbing the guidelines. shall we overwork ourselves and no longer know it. It’s simplest after we exhibit up for an exam or must perform that new piece of track that we know if all that follow actually worked. “It’s very onerous for people to be self-reflective about their very own cognitive state and workload,” Yuksel says.

An observant trainer would possibly be able to inform when a scholar is ready to analyze new subject material, however a computer can do it significantly better by using in truth peering inside their brain. BACh customers put on unique sensors attached to their foreheads that measure blood float in the prefrontal cortex, which serves as the mind’s keep an eye on middle for larger cognitive features like multitasking, resolution making, and short-time period reminiscence. “whilst you think,” Yuksel explains, “your coronary heart pumps more blood and extra oxygen to that part of the brain.”

in line with blood waft, BACh can inform how exhausting a pupil’s mind is working, and simplest releases a brand new line of song as soon as the learner’s cognitive load is gentle, indicating they’ve mastered the primary line comfortably. And so far, the expertise proves actually promising. in a single learn about, individuals who learned new songs the use of BACh performed more right notes and made fewer errors than those participants finding out on their own. they also played the piece sooner than the keep an eye on team. And these weren’t experts—Yuksel only recruited freshmen for the learn about.

“It’s the primary time we have this purpose bodily measurement of cognitive load that helps individuals analyze in real time,” Yuksel says. Now she and her adviser, Robert Jacob, a professor of pc science, are working on the usage of BACh to measure emotions in addition to cognitive load. “as an instance, if frustration or anxiety are excessive while workload is excessive, it could indicate they’re overloaded,” she says. “Then i might decrease the quantity of information or offer to lend a hand.”

while now we have bought some work to do ahead of we will plug our brains into a pc and obtain knowledge, Matrix-fashion, Jacob envisions a future the place our devices come with constructed-in mini-BACh techniques that work with a wearable, so college students can observe their own psychological load. if truth be told, his colleagues within the electrical engineering division are already engaged on prototypes. “imagine this hooked up to your telephone or Google Glass,” he says. “There’s nothing preventing this. It’s potential.”

For Yuksel, piano is just the primary of many conceivable purposes. She says BACh can be used to show virtually any new talent, from math to foreign language. “you must design the device however you need,” she says. “should you have been teaching little children how to read, it’s essential start with the letters of the alphabet and construct onto two-letter phrases. as long as it’s a job that may be broken down into completely different ranges of problem, you could raise the issue as cognitive load falls beneath a definite threshold. you might want to design for little children up to graduate-stage electrical engineers. this system is a first step, but a formidable one.”
